Description
The programme PHEBUS was set up to study the behavior of water reactor fuel elements in the event of a depressurization hitch. Amongst other things it should allow the computing codes describing depressurization and rewetting to be ajusted for application to the calculation of power reactor accidents. It should also allow to investigate the behavior of fuel elements and the efficiency of the safety injection
